Jeju International University in Korea is a comprehensive undergraduate university formed by the merger of the former Jeju Rhoda University and Korea University of Industrial Information in March 20 12. Its majors are mechanical cars, tourism management, aviation services and golf.

In order to realize the internationalization of education and research, a special strategy "A(sia) Plan" has been formulated, and three strategic steps of internationalization have been defined, namely, the internationalization of educational projects, the plan of learning from South Korea and the plan of vigorously cultivating world citizens, and they have been working hard to achieve the planned goals. As the executing agency of the A(sia) project, the International Exchange Center was established on July 6th, 2005. On the one hand, we strive to expand exchanges with foreign universities, on the other hand, we continue to make efforts in student exchanges and credit exchange, dual-degree system and short-term training programs to cultivate talents that meet the requirements of the international era. In addition, in order to attract foreign students and realize the internationalization of universities, publicity activities have been actively carried out. Korean language training programs for foreigners, Jeju International City and Jeju Special Autonomy System, and plans to cultivate world citizens are all in full swing.

Foreign students with excellent grades can get an extra scholarship of 10% through selection. The work-study environment is good, and the campus is located in Sekuipo, a tourist city in Jeju Island. The school can see the famous Halla Mountain and the Pacific Ocean in Korea, and the tourism and related industries are very developed, which creates conditions for students to work and study. The school uniformly applies for the activity license (work-study program license) of the Korean Ministry of Development for each student. Students can work and study legally.
